US hot rolled bar imports up 32.9 percent in May

Monday, 13 July 2020 19:31:30 (GMT+3)   |   San Diego
       

According to final census data from the US Department of Commerce, US imports of hot rolled bar totaled 58,879 mt in May 2020, up 32.9 percent from April but down 26.6 percent from May 2019 levels. By value, hot rolled bar imports totaled $50.8 million in May 2020, compared to $41.2 million in the previous month and $80.6 million in the same month last year.

The US imported the most hot rolled bar from Japan in May, with 21,276 mt, compared to 12,475 mt in April and 16,657 mt in May 2019. Other top sources of imported hot rolled bar in May include Canada, with 16,100 mt; Germany, with 4,826 mt; Mexico, with 4,505 mt; and France, with 3,061 mt.
